    12 play along with a song track on/off use the pads and pedals to play along with a song accompaniment. The dd-50’s song accompaniment consists of 4 tracks; drum 1/2, bass, and backing tracks. • the dd-50 can play a total of 28 notes simultaneously.     18 local on/off setting the local on/off determines whether or not the internal voices respond to the notes you play on the dd-50’s pads. Setting this to off disconnects the dd-50’s pads from the voices. How- ever, data produced by the dd-50 is transmitted via the midi out terminal. 1 display the lo...
